How they compare

MDG: Latin America and the Caribbean currently reports 76.7% against 64.9% in Rwanda, a difference of 11.8%.

That makes MDG: Latin America and the Caribbean's figure about 1.2 times Rwanda's.

Across all 23 years both countries report, MDG: Latin America and the Caribbean has been ahead every year.

MDG: Latin America and the Caribbean ranks 137th and Rwanda ranks 139th of 221 groups.

MDG: Latin America and the Caribbean has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ade MDG: Latin America and the Caribbean Rwanda Difference Ahead
1990s 80.0% 32.9% 47.1% MDG: Latin America and the Caribbean
2000s 82.9% 45.9% 37.0% MDG: Latin America and the Caribbean
2010s 78.6% 62.7% 16.0% MDG: Latin America and the Caribbean
2020s 77.1% 62.9% 14.2% MDG: Latin America and the Caribbean

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
